Ti15Al11Ni74 is a titanium-based intermetallic compound with significant aluminum and nickel content, representing a ternary titanium aluminide system. This material family is primarily explored in high-temperature structural applications where lightweight performance and thermal stability are critical, though Ti15Al11Ni74 specifically appears to be a research composition rather than an established commercial alloy. The material's potential lies in aerospace and power generation sectors where reducing component weight while maintaining strength at elevated temperatures drives material development, though it faces competition from more mature titanium alloys and nickel superalloys with better-established processing routes and property reliability.
